Transaction 56fcdac73e2450440498df6cb7cd250f1e73fe10aa44197873071def62d5c04f

1 Input
2 Outputs
  • 56fcdac73e2450440498df6cb7cd250f1e73fe10aa44197873071def62d5c04f:0
  • value  5151200
    address  3KfseBjyxt3R5ET1WkVRm2wC4bWvrhSfed
  • 56fcdac73e2450440498df6cb7cd250f1e73fe10aa44197873071def62d5c04f:1
  • value  4934732
    address  3LTaeqppXo6yyrW8a92YNxbuc7Y9TsRjMG